This interactive map is also quite interesting, based on Spotify data:

Every Noise at Once is an ongoing attempt at an algorithmically-generated, readability-adjusted scatter-plot of the musical genre-space, based on data tracked and analyzed for 5,261 genre-shaped distinctions by Spotify as of 2021-03-16. The calibration is fuzzy, but in general down is more organic, up is more mechanical and electric; left is denser and more atmospheric, right is spikier and bouncier.

Integrating RateYourMusic (RYM) genres and album reviews into Roon could indeed enhance the service’s music information. RYM’s community-generated genre data, along with its voting system, offers detailed and accurate insights into music categorization. Incorporating RYM’s extensive genre information, primary and secondary, would provide Roon users with a richer and more nuanced understanding of the music they’re exploring. Additionally, leveraging RYM’s album reviews, known for their depth and community-driven nature, would contribute to a more comprehensive and user-focused music experience within Roon.
